WebMay 1, 2024 · If you’re over 70 you must renew your driving licence every three years. If you have certain medical conditions - like glaucoma - you must meet the minimum eyesight requirement to renew your licence, which often requires an eye test. WebOnce you’re 70 you’ll need to renew your driving licence every 3 years. The DVLA will automatically send you a D46P application form 90 days before your licence expires. …
WebSep 24, 2024 · After that first renewal, you will then need to renew it every three years but most importantly, you don't need to resit the actual practical driving test. You can renew your licence online for free if you're 70 years or over, or if your 70th birthday is within 90 days. If you choose to renew by post then the DVLA will send you a D46P ...
